Has The University of Lagos[UNILAG] 2023/2024 Cut Off Mark been announced? We’re pleased to inform the general public especially readers who made UNILAG their first choice that the long-awaited cutoff mark for the 2023/2024 admission screening exercise has been announced by the management of the institution.

Meeting the minimum cut off mark makes you eligible to register for the screening exercise only and does not guarantee that you would be admitted by the institution as there are other criteria used when accessing candidate’s applications.

The Joint Admission and Matriculation Board[JAMB] had earlier announced that the minimum cut off mark for the 2023/2024 admission screening exercise is 140 but institutions are allowed to set their minimum cut off marks but not above the required or set limit.

UNILAG 2023/2024 Cut Off Mark[Departmental & JAMB]

The JAMB 2023/2024 Cut off mark is 140 while the UNILAG Departmental cut off mark is 200 meaning candidates who made the institution their first choice are expected to score a minimum of 200 in JAMB to be eligible to register for the screening exercise.

What To Do If You Did Not Meet The Cut Off Mark

There are situations where the candidates do not meet the minimum cut off mark and one of the questions such persons use to ask is “What Should I do?”. There are two things involved either you obtain a JAMB change of institution form or a change of course form.

Competitive departments tend to have numerous applications on a yearly basis and some of such courses or departments are Medicine & Surgery, Nursing, Computer Science, and Accounting. Candidates who selected any of the departments outlined above should ensure that they score very high and have good O level requirements also.
